Restore the Lost Covenant (The Covenant Journey)



Acts 1:1, 3 and 8 “But you will receive power when the Holy Spirit has come upon you, and you will be my witnesses in Jerusalem and in all Judea and Samaria, and to the end of the earth.” (8)

The covenant of Acts 1:1, 3, and 8 was confirmed through Christ, but it existed from the beginning. You lost hold of this Covenant Journey and as a result, Satan made you and your future generations into slaves who were deceived by war(strategy) and ran errands for the sake of idolatry. You lost your identity; was led into a life of captivity; and became numb or desensitized while being colonized. You wandered around aimlessly and lived in the midst of disasters. That’s why, God gave the covenant of world evangelization through Remnants who possessed the Gospel and gathered all answers to them. Then, what Covenant Journey must you go on?

1. The Start of the Covenant and the Age of Restoration
There are sign posts or milestones on the Covenant Journey. God gave the covenant when there was nothing(Nobody). The family lines of Noah and Abraham were witnesses. Furthermore, when a path didn’t exist(No Way), God restored the covenant through Joseph and Moses. For those who had gotten lost, God revealed the path that they had to take.

2. The Completion of the Covenant and Conquest and the Age of Completion
When the covenant was lost during the age of Philistia(No Time), God restored the covenantal time schedule through Samuel and David. God also opened the age of conquest during the times of Assyria; Aram; and Babylon(Nowhere) and made Elisha; Esther; Daniel; Shadrach; Meshach; and Abednego know the value of staking their lives. Finally, in the age of Rome, God opened the age of fulfilling the covenant through the Early Church. In the fields that lacked answers(No Answer), God conquered the world with the answer that Jesus Christ had finished all problems.

Starting today, there is absolutely no reason to be discouraged. From a field where nobody exists, God will lead you to a place where you can save everything. You’re not idly standing by without any inclination of hope. You’re hoping in anticipation for God's covenant.
